In your home folder should not be a /usr folder, only in /root.

What do you want to do with /usr? Do you want to create systemwide actions? Then you should put them to /usr/share/nemo/actions.
This offers the advantage that you can also see the actions in the context menu when you use nemo with administrator rights.
For actions that are only for your user you can create them at ~/.local/share/nemo/actions.

I changed the selection from "none" to "any"
Selection=any
and "Refresh" is shown in right-click menu.

Well I finally figured it out I did everything correctly EXCEPT the guy creating the video forgot one little thing in his video .... you have to install xdotool on your computer .... he mentioned it in the comments below the video .... which I very seldom read .... it now works fine ....
